Output 7f0de221e6ec5e158d126f58dc2ed938ea5c5da78b1d9ac19a0fed5f89925ad1:45

value
1143622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5c907b67dac1205c12b2a838e43a27187a80c62 OP_EQUAL
address
3Q6cJMrdF219uxX64sNK81vVAri37G5kcV
transaction
7f0de221e6ec5e158d126f58dc2ed938ea5c5da78b1d9ac19a0fed5f89925ad1
confirmations
264691
spent
true